## Service accounts for the Mergewren dedupe tool

Hey support folks — when customers report duplicate records, the Mergewren service account does the heavy lifting: it scans, scores matches, and merges profiles overnight. Don't run merges under your personal login; always use the service account so the audit trail stays clean. For read-only lookups in the dedupe dashboard, use the key below.

API key for yahig-tadup: kto7_ubizbYm

## Onboarding: Renderloop Transcoding Farm

Welcome to the Renderloop team at Vexa Media. The farm's control plane credentials are sealed in a local vault on each scheduler node. During your first on-call shift, you may need to reopen a sealed node after a power event. Proceed carefully and confirm with your shift lead first. The recovery passphrase follows below.

vault phrase of taweg-kafof = oliax-zorael

## Deploying the Gatewick Proctor Queue

Deploys are pretty painless: push to main, wait for the pipeline, then watch the queue drain dashboard for five minutes. If candidates pile up mid-exam, roll back first and ask questions later — the queue replays safely. Everything the workers care about lives in one config block, shown here for reference.

settings of bafof-yagef:
JOROX_PIN=8740
JOROX_TENANT=pelox
JOROX_METRICS_HOST=metrics.jorox.qorvelworks.internal
JOROX_SEAL=seal_c78f63c1
JOROX_STANDBY_TEAM=norax

Alert: DocSentry lint failure rate above threshold. This fires when more than 15% of documentation builds in the Wrenfold monorepo fail the linter over a rolling hour. Common causes: a rule bump merged without a grace period, or a broken cross-reference after a directory move. The alert is informational, not paging; it exists so maintainers notice rule drift before the weekly docs freeze. To investigate, start with the failing-rule breakdown and recent rule-change log on the internal page below.

dashboard of yafog-fajof = https://jira.tolvaqsys.internal/pages/pages/projects/49fe21c4